Not only do we engage in stupid wars without end abroad, killing thousands of American's armed forces, we also wage a stupid war without end at home. The domestic “War on Drugs” has lead to the unnecessary death of law enforcers and thousands of civilians here and in other countries with results as successful as is the Iraq / Afghanistan wars.
Law Enforcement Against Prohibition (LEAP) represents police, prosecutors, judges, prison warders, federal agents and others who want to legalize and regulate drugs after fighting on the front lines of the "war on drugs" and learning firsthand that prohibition only serves to worsen addiction and violence.Peace Officers Memorial Day is this week, and some cops are saying we need to legalize drugs to stop police from dying in the failed "Drug War."Too many law enforcers are killed in the line of duty enforcing a senseless and unwinnable War On Drugs, according to LEAP which is calling for the legalization and regulation of all drugs.
